Best Security System for Apartment: Top Choices for 2025

Selecting the best security system for an apartment involves evaluating several factors, including installation ease, cost, monitoring options, and smart home compatibility. Unlike standalone homes, apartments often have restrictions on drilling or wiring, making wireless systems a preferred choice. Additionally, renters may need landlord approval for certain installations, so flexibility is key. Below, we break down the top security systems for apartments, their features, and how they compare.
Key Features to Consider
When choosing a security system for an apartment, prioritize the following features:
- Wireless Design: Avoids the need for drilling or complex wiring.
- Easy Installation: DIY setups save time and money.
- Affordable Monitoring: Look for flexible plans, including self-monitoring.
- Smart Home Integration: Compatibility with devices like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ant.
- Portability: Easy to move if you relocate.
Top Security Systems for Apartments
Here are the leading security systems for apartments in 2025:
1. SimpliSafe Home Security System
SimpliSafe is a popular choice for renters due to its wireless design and easy setup. The system includes sensors for doors, windows, and motion detection, along with optional 24/7 professional monitoring. Its portability makes it ideal for those who move frequently.
2. Ring Alarm Security Kit
Ring offers an affordable, scalable system with seamless integration into the Ring ecosystem. Users can add cameras, doorbells, and sensors as needed. The system supports self-monitoring or professional monitoring for a low monthly fee.
3. Abode Smart Security Kit
Abode provides a versatile system with both DIY and professional monitoring options. It supports a wide range of smart home devices and offers automation features, making it a great choice for tech-savvy users.
4. Google Nest Secure
Google Nest Secure combines security with smart home functionality. The system includes a hub, sensors, and optional cameras, all controllable via the Google Home app. Its sleek design blends well with modern apartments.
5. Arlo Pro 4 Security System
Arlo Pro 4 focuses on wireless cameras with advanced features like 2K video, color night vision, and a built-in siren. It’s ideal for those who prioritize video surveillance.
